Mixed Reality (MR) technologies offer a wide range of applications in enterprise and industrial settings, enhancing productivity, efficiency, and collaboration. Here are two key use cases:

1. Remote Collaboration and Telepresence:

  • Virtual Meetings: MR enables virtual meetings and collaboration among geographically dispersed teams. Participants can join virtual rooms or spaces where they appear as avatars, allowing for more immersive and engaging interactions.
  • Real-Time Communication: MR facilitates real-time communication through spatial audio and 3D avatars, providing a sense of presence. This is particularly valuable for team meetings, brainstorming sessions, and project discussions.
  • Data Visualization: MR allows participants to visualize complex data, such as 3D models, charts, and simulations, in a shared virtual space. This enhances data-driven discussions and decision-making.
  • Training and Education: MR is used for remote training and education sessions. Instructors can lead classes or workshops while students interact with virtual content and collaborate with peers.

2. Maintenance and Repair Assistance:

  • Augmented Maintenance: MR provides real-time assistance to field technicians and maintenance personnel. Technicians wear MR headsets that overlay digital instructions, schematics, and annotations onto physical equipment, guiding them through maintenance procedures.
  • Remote Expert Support: MR enables remote experts to assist on-site technicians by seeing what they see through their MR headsets. Experts can offer guidance, mark up the technician’s field of view, and provide live instructions for troubleshooting and repair.
  • Reduced Downtime: MR-assisted maintenance reduces downtime by improving the efficiency and accuracy of repair procedures. Technicians can access relevant information and expertise instantly, minimizing equipment downtime.
  • Training and Onboarding: MR is used for training new technicians and onboarding employees. Trainees can learn by doing, with step-by-step instructions overlaid on their view, gaining hands-on experience.

These MR applications enhance collaboration, streamline maintenance processes, and contribute to cost savings in enterprise and industrial contexts. They leverage the immersive and interactive nature of MR to provide real-time support, training, and data visualization, ultimately improving productivity and reducing errors.
